前端主要掌握HTML、CSS和JavaScript,后端推荐Python、Java或Node.js,若追求全栈高效开发,建议以JavaScript生态为核心,辅以SQL数据库技能。

网站开发并非单一语言的竞技,而是前端交互、后端逻辑与数据管理的系统工程,在2026年的技术语境下,语言的选择直接决定了开发效率、维护成本及项目扩展性,以下将从不同角色需求出发,拆解关键语言及其应用场景。
前端开发:构建视觉与交互的基石
前端是用户直接感知的部分,其技术栈已高度标准化,任何现代网站开发,无论后端多么复杂,前端基础不可或缺。
核心基础三剑客
- HTML5:负责网页结构,它是语义化的标签语言,2026年依然占据绝对主导地位,支持多媒体嵌入及无障碍访问标准。
- CSS3:负责样式与布局,通过Flexbox和Grid布局,实现响应式设计,确保网站在手机、平板及桌面端完美适配。
- JavaScript (ES6+):负责动态交互,作为唯一能在浏览器原生运行的脚本语言,它是前端逻辑的核心。
框架与库的选择
原生JS虽强大,但大型项目需借助框架提升效率。
- React:由Meta维护,组件化思维成熟,生态庞大,适合构建复杂单页应用(SPA)。
- Vue.js:在国内中小企业及中后台管理系统中占有率极高,上手曲线平缓,文档友好。
- Angular:Google支持,重型框架,适合大型企业级应用,强调规范与类型安全。
后端开发:处理逻辑与数据的核心
后端负责业务逻辑、API接口及数据库交互,2026年,后端语言呈现“多极化”趋势,不同语言在性能、开发速度与生态上各有优劣。

主流后端语言对比
| 语言 | 典型框架 | 优势场景 | 学习难度 | 2026年市场热度 |
|---|---|---|---|---|
| JavaScript (Node.js) | Express, NestJS | 全栈统一语言,高并发I/O密集型应用 | 中 | 极高(全栈首选) |
| Python | Django, FastAPI | 快速原型开发,AI集成,数据驱动型网站 | 低 | 高(初创及AI项目) |
| Java | Spring Boot | 大型企业级系统,高稳定性,复杂业务逻辑 | 高 | 稳定(金融/电商) |
| Go (Golang) | Gin, Echo | 微服务架构,高性能并发处理 | 中 | 上升(云原生领域) |
场景化选型建议
- 初创团队或独立开发者:强烈建议学习Node.js,掌握JavaScript即可打通前后端,减少上下文切换成本,极大提升迭代速度。
- 传统企业或金融系统:Java仍是不可替代的基石,其类型安全、生态完善及长期稳定性,符合国企及大型机构对系统可靠性的严苛要求。
- AI赋能型网站:Python是最佳选择,其丰富的机器学习库(如PyTorch, TensorFlow)可直接嵌入后端,实现智能推荐、图像识别等功能。
数据库与全栈技能补充
语言之外,数据存储是网站开发的另一支柱。
SQL与NoSQL
- MySQL/PostgreSQL:关系型数据库,数据一致性要求高的业务(如订单、用户信息)首选。
- MongoDB:文档型数据库,适合数据结构频繁变动或海量非结构化数据场景。
全栈思维的重要性
2026年的招聘趋势更倾向于“T型人才”,即在一门语言上深耕(如Java后端),同时具备另一门语言的基础能力(如JS前端),这种复合能力能显著降低沟通成本,提升独立交付能力。
常见问题解答 (FAQ)
Q1: 零基础入门网站开发,先学Python还是JavaScript?
建议优先学习JavaScript,因为前端是网站开发的必经之路,且Node.js允许你使用同一语言进行后端开发,路径最短,Python虽简单,但需额外学习前端技术才能完成完整网站构建。
Q2: 2026年学习Go语言做网站开发有前景吗?
有前景,但定位不同,Go适合构建高并发、微服务架构的后端服务,若目标是快速搭建中小型网站,Go的学习成本和维护生态不如Node.js或Python友好;若目标进入大厂后端架构组,Go是必备技能。

Q3: 网站开发需要掌握多少种语言才能找到工作?
精通1-2种核心语言即可,JS+Node.js”或“Java+Vue”,盲目追求多语言会导致样样通样样松,企业更看重你在某一技术栈的深度及解决复杂问题的能力。
希望以上分析能为你指明学习方向,欢迎在评论区留言你的职业目标,我将为你提供更具体的学习路径建议。
参考文献
- 中国信息通信研究院. (2026). 《2026年中国Web前端技术发展趋势白皮书》. 北京: 中国信通院.
- Stack Overflow. (2026). Most Popular, Desired & Dreaded Technologies Survey 2026. Retrieved from stackoverflow.com.
- 王坚. (2025). 《云计算与Web架构演进:从单体到微服务》. 杭州: 阿里巴巴集团技术部内部报告.
- MDN Web Docs. (2026). JavaScript Language Reference. Mozilla Developer Network.
图片来源于AI模型,如侵权请联系管理员。作者:酷小编,如若转载,请注明出处:https://www.kufanyun.com/ask/589577.html


评论列表(2条)
这篇文章写得非常好,内容丰富,观点清晰,让我受益匪浅。特别是关于前端主要掌握的部分,分析得很到位,给了我很多新的启发和思考。感谢作者的精心创作和分享,期待看到更多这样高质量的内容!
这篇文章的内容非常有价值,我从中学习到了很多新的知识和观点。作者的写作风格简洁明了,却又不失深度,让人读起来很舒服。特别是前端主要掌握部分,给了我很多新的思路。感谢分享这么好的内容!